Barmotara Population - Araria, Bihar
Barmotara is a medium size village located in Bhargama Block of Araria district, Bihar with total 172 families residing. The Barmotara village has population of 907 of which 469 are males while 438 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Barmotara village population of children with age 0-6 is 192 which makes up 21.17 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Barmotara village is 934 which is higher than Bihar state average of 918. Child Sex Ratio for the Barmotara as per census is 1000, higher than Bihar average of 935.
Barmotara village has lower literacy rate compared to Bihar. In 2011, literacy rate of Barmotara village was 36.08 % compared to 61.80 % of Bihar. In Barmotara Male literacy stands at 40.21 % while female literacy rate was 31.58 %.
